The Groceries vs. Supermarkets: Their role in the Lake District’s Tourism
Groceries in the Lake District and Europe in its entirety can not simply replaced by large supermarkets.  Neighborhood grocery stores are already part of the Europe’s culture as seen in its towns and districts like the groceries in the Lake District. However, in the past decades, the rise of Metro stores has been growing like molds and it seems that the degeneration of independent smaller stores has been eaten away by supermarkets.
The rise popular supermarkets and hypermarkets in Europe like Tesco and Sainsbury’s that reached the neighborhood shows a great influence and has caused the deterioration of many small grocery stores.
Nevertheless, going back to the budding growth of tourism, there is still a hope for locally-owned groceries in the Lake District.
